WEST v. CARR


370 S.W.2d 469 (1963)

Ben WEST, Mayor, etc. v. Joe C. CARR, Secretary of State, et al.

Supreme Court of Tennessee.

May 10, 1963.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Harris A. Gilbert and Z. T. Osborn, Jr., Nashville, Denny, Leftwich & Osborn, Nashville, Robert Jennings, City Atty., Nashville, of counsel, for complainants.

George F. McCanless, Atty. Gen., Thomas E. Fox, Asst. Atty. Gen., Nashville, for Joe C. Carr.

Shelton Luton, Davidson County Atty., Nashville, for Commissioners of Election for Davidson County.

Edwin F. Hunt, Nashville, amicus curiæ on behalf of Tennessee Farm Bureau Federation, Inc., et al.


FELTS, Justice.

This suit was brought by Ben West, as Mayor of the City of Nashville and as a voter and taxpayer of Davidson County, under the Declaratory Judgments Act (T.C.A. §§ 23-1101 to 23-1113), seeking a decree declaring Chapter 2, Acts 1962, unconstitutional and enjoining the defendants, the Secretary of State, the Attorney General, and the Election Commissioners of Davidson County, from expending any public funds or holding the elections provided...
